Future looks bright

- By Georgia Smith

The culminatio­n of a year of hard work and studying all comes down to this moment.

ATARs were released to students throughout Victoria on Friday, and none were quite as happy as Benalla FCJ College Dux Jazzy Burke.

Receiving an exceptiona­l ATAR score of 98.65, life after school is looking bright for the high achiever.

‘‘I was so nervous, it took me ages to fall asleep the night before,’’ Jazzy said.

‘‘For me it was never really about getting Dux, it was about doing well and getting the score I needed to get into my course. ‘‘I just wanted to do my personal best.’’ Jazzy has already started putting plans into place for next year, hoping to start a doubledegr­ee in science and engineerin­g at Monash University.

While Jazzy did not quite expect to receive the score she got, she had an inkling that she was in a good position to do well.

‘‘I did an ATAR calculator back at the start of Year 11 and it was almost exactly the same as my score, but I didn’t actually think I would get that,’’ Jazzy said.

She was not the only student to do well on results day, with Sarah Bismire named proxime accessit for FCJ College with an ATAR score of 89.3.

‘‘I wanted to get an 80 to get into a Bachelor of Arts at Melbourne University,’’ Sarah said. ‘‘I was very excited when I saw my score. ‘‘Your ATAR doesn’t define you, at the end of the day if you have done your best what else can you do?’’

Sarah is now set to spend next year in England working in a boarding school, but not before she celebrates her score with her family over her favourite meal — a rack of lamb.

FCJ College principal Joanne Rock said the school was proud of both girls.

‘‘They have worked really hard and both of them deserve the score they got,’’ Ms Rock said.

‘‘They have been great role models to the rest of the student population.

‘‘They are going to be an asset to society once they work out what they want to do, they are both change agents and people that want to make things happen.

‘‘I know they have a great grounding and will make the right choice and create some positive change in the world around them.’’
